My new setup: 20x9 Moto Metal 951 (+18 offset, 5.71 backspacing) with Toyo Open Country M/T 35x12.50-20. Here are the pics. Hope ya'll enjoy!

Looks good!
He only has a leveling kit and as you can see in the pics, he had to do a good bit of trimming. However, he was trying to stuff 35's with minimal lift. Most people run 33's with his combo of lift/wheel size.
